# --- Catalogue Import Settings (Thornbury Library System) ---
# The nightly import pulls MARC records from the Wexhall feed and upserts
# them into the `catalogue_items` table. Runs at 02:30 local; typical
# duration is 20 minutes. If the job exceeds an hour, check for a held
# lock on `import_batches` before killing it — partial batches are safe
# to re-run. Duplicate detection keys on the record fingerprint column.
# The importer connects to the catalogue database with the string below.

replica DSN, kajep-yahag: mssql://praok_svc:iF@db-8d68.plorvaio.local:5432/eliion

Support should note that the widget degrades to a plain text field after three timeouts, which customers often report as "autocomplete disappeared." Test both the embedded mode and the standalone Fernvale portal integration, and confirm suggestions respect the tenant's configured region filter. Screen-reader announcements must fire on each suggestion change. All test calls to the staging geocoder are authorized with the bearer token below.

session JWT of yawep-yawep = eyJhbGciOiJIUzI1NiIsInR5cCI6IkpXVCJ9.eyJzdWIiOiI3pWF3_In0.aXYsHiog

// Waveform preview renderer for the Chordelia upload pipeline.
// These constants control downsampling and peak-bucket sizing; if
// previews look jagged or render slowly on large stems, check here
// first before touching the worker pool. Changing bucket width
// invalidates cached previews, so coordinate with the cache flush
// job. Current tuning values are listed below.

tuning table, fawip-fahag:
WEIGHTS = {
    "novwyn": 452,
    "casdor": 675,
}

Pilot Churn — Managers Only

Quick update for sales leads on the Marrowgate pilot. We've lost four of the eighteen pilot accounts since launch, mostly smaller shops in the Dunsbury region who found Quillsync's onboarding too heavy. Retention among larger accounts is actually solid — Pellworth Traders just expanded seats. Tomas is drafting a lighter onboarding flow for the next cohort. Don't quote churn numbers externally until we've cleaned the data. The wider plan this feeds into is noted below.

confidential, bahap-bajog: Zorethix Works is in early talks to buy Kelethox Foods for about $30.7 million. The Ralvan launch date is September 19, and nothing goes to the press before then.